Council President Hucker and Vice President Albornoz to hold media availability on July 12 at 11 a.m. to discuss new minority-owned business bill and other Council related matters

For Immediate Release: Friday, July 9, 2021

Rockville, Md., July 9, 2021—On Monday, July 12 at 11 a.m., Council President Tom Hucker and Council Vice President Gabe Albornoz will hold a media availability to discuss a new bill and special appropriation being introduced by the full Council and spearheaded by Council President Hucker for the County's minority-owned business purchasing program, a Council resolution in support of Medicare for All and other Council related matters.

The duo will provide an overview of the Working Families Income Credit that begins on July 15 and discuss the recent dedication of, and ribbon-cutting ceremony for, Marian Fryer Town Plaza in Wheaton. They will also provide a brief COVID-19 update with information from the Director of the Department of Health and Human Services Dr. Raymond Crowel.

The media availability will be held via Zoom and is for credentialed members of the media.

The public can watch on the Council’s Facebook page (@MontgomeryCountyMdCouncil).
